The Story of Dakotah

Dakotah is an alternate spelling of Dakota, derived from the Dakota Sioux word 'dakhota' or 'lakota,' meaning 'allies' or 'friends.' The Dakota people are one of the three divisions of the Great Sioux Nation, indigenous to the northern Great Plains of North America. The name carries the spirit of kinship and communal belonging central to Plains Indian culture.

Dakota gained widespread use as a given name in the 1990s, boosted by actress Dakota Fanning's rise to fame in the early 2000s. The alternative 'Dakotah' spelling has been used by parents seeking a more individualized take on the name. It remains popular across the American Midwest and South, particularly in rural communities.

The name honors the Dakota people, whose homelands now encompass North and South Dakota. In Lakota and Dakota culture, the concept of 'mitakuye oyasin' (all are related) reflects the communal spirit embedded in the name's meaning of 'friend' or 'ally.'

Historical Record

Dakotah first appeared in US Social Security records in 1979.

Over 3,123 babies have been named Dakotah in the United States since SSA records began.

Today, Dakotah is past its peak , currently ranked #4,877 for boy names in the US .

Fun Facts

  • The states of North and South Dakota take their names from the Dakota Sioux people
  • Dakota Fanning became one of the youngest actresses ever nominated for a Screen Actors Guild Award at age 9
  • The Lakota word 'koda' means friend or ally and is the root of this name
